Welsh Springer Spaniel - family but hunting

A lot of people seeing Welsh for the first time are amazed by how the dog looks like, when they read information about the breed on the internet they learn that it is a wonderful, sociable dog and doesn’t show any certain type of aggression, what is more, they find out that Welsh is the perfect candidate to became a new family member. Yes, everything that was mentioned before is true. Welsh Springer Spaniel has wonderful ginger – white coat with many drops ( freckles ) on the muzzle and paws. Their fur is pleasant in the touch. The dog gets attached to the householders and accepts everyone, no matter if they are two-legged or four-legged. After Welsh will make their appearance in the house, there is no doubt that they will become a great friend as well as a householder, however, every rose has its thorns.

Springers are not that kind of dog, that can only be a decoration for the house. If we take a look at the classification of the FCI ( Federation Cynologique Internationale ) breeds, we are going to find Welsh under group VIII – flushing dogs, fetching dogs, and water dogs. Welsh can be found in this group of dogs not by accident, if Welsh Springer Spaniel was a breed only for the company, it would be classified in group IX – decorative and companion dogs.

As I mentioned before Welsh Springer Spaniel is classified in group VIII, so is a flushing dog. They are hunting dogs, working tirelessly in the harsh conditions and that was the main goal of creating this breed. The dog’s main tasks is to flush the birds from bushes and swamps, fetch from water and locate shot birds. Welsh that is deprived of a chance to work will suffer. Of course, not every Springer’s owner has to be a hunter, however, every conscious owner has to be aware of his pet’s needs, be mindful of the breed’s roots and provide optimal conditions for their dog, considering dog’s character.
Purchasing a puppy is only the beginning of our long-standing journey with the dog. Since the first day, we need to start working with them. I wrote on purpose “with them” not “on them”, mainly because us, owners we need to learn how to cooperate with our best friend and systematically build a relationship with them.
Welsh is an intelligent dog, they learn fast, however, they are also very independent, so we can’t expect from them to be obedient like a German Shepperd, in fact, the best learning methods for the Welsh Springer Spaniel are those that are focused on rewarding. We also need to keep in mind that the first six months of a puppy’s life is the most important period. When taking dog into our house we need to book the first months of our time just for the puppy. In that time the dog’s psyche is shaping, and how we will work through this period is going to decide what kind of dog we will have in the future. Of course, it doesn’t mean that after 6 months our work is over. No, each day is a new challenge, we can expect a mature, shaped dog after around 3 years.

Welsh Springer Spaniels are very eager to work, want to be close with their owner, and do tasks for them. Welsh always wants to be close with the human, they don’t like staying home alone, sadly sometimes, despite the work that was done during the “puppy period”, leaving dog home alone can be impossible. This is the result of Welsh’s attachment and love that they have for us. Of course, those traits are highly desirable for all the owners, but we should be aware that we will have to turn our life-styles around after letting Welsh Springer Spaniel into our house. We need to take under consideration our fellow while planning vacations or longer absences from home. We need to show them our affection daily, not only by petting and hugging them, but also by various ways of spending time with them. Every walk should be intertwined with some sort of work, play or learn. It is also worth taking the dog by the water, so they have a chance to swim.
I am convinced Welsh is going to feel comfortable in an active people’s house, where there is always going to be someone who will give the dog a second of theirs time. It is worth considering signing up our dog for classes, from the very beginning, starting with puppy kindergarten. Our attention should be paid to the schools that offer stress-free training. Such schools pay particular attention to build our relationship with the dog, and what is more important educate us, owners. Thanks to this we get a rich resource of working methods, that we can use later during daily activities with our dog. It is also worth considering to take our dog to the hunting dog training, it can also be done by scent training, agility training, or any type of activity that will allow our dog to work and use their utility abilities.
